Cogliano leads Anaheim over Phoenix E-mail
Written by Sports Know It Alls Staff   

Andrew Cogliano scored three goals on Tuesday to lead the Anaheim Ducks past the Phoenix Coyotes, 4-1.

Cogliano scored all his goals in the second quarter, giving the Ducks momentum throughout the period that rippled throughout the contest.

Anaheim’s other goal was an empty netter from Teemu Selanne.

Ray Whitney of the Coyotes scored the first goal of the game, granting them a 1-0 lead at the end of the first. However, Cogliano took over the second period and the Ducks never looked back.

Anaheim goalie Jonas Hiller blocked 25 shots en route to the win.
